More about IGD
At IGD (Institute of Grocery Distribution), we serve as a unique, impartial force for good, driven by our charitable status and commitment to public benefit. Our purpose is clear: to unite and inspire everyone to deliver a thriving food system. We achieve this by acting as a trusted convener, uniting stakeholders from across the entire agrifood supply chain to address critical challenges.
We foster collaboration through a broad range of forums, bringing together businesses, policymakers, and thought leaders. By providing evidence-based insights, credible research, and strategic foresight, we help organisations make informed decisions that not only benefit their operations but also contribute to the collective good of society.
This is funded through our work with hundreds of clients from across the global food and consumer goods landscape.
